411573Srgrimes/*
421573Srgrimes * Copy src to dst, truncating or null-padding to always copy n bytes.
431573Srgrimes * Return dst.
441573Srgrimes */
451573Srgrimeschar *
46103012Stjrstrncpy(char * __restrict dst, const char * __restrict src, size_t n)
471573Srgrimes{
481573Srgrimes	if (n != 0) {
4992889Sobrien		char *d = dst;
5092889Sobrien		const char *s = src;
511573Srgrimes
521573Srgrimes		do {
53188080Sdanger			if ((*d++ = *s++) == '\0') {
541573Srgrimes				/* NUL pad the remaining n-1 bytes */
551573Srgrimes				while (--n != 0)
56188080Sdanger					*d++ = '\0';
571573Srgrimes				break;
581573Srgrimes			}
591573Srgrimes		} while (--n != 0);
601573Srgrimes	}
611573Srgrimes	return (dst);
621573Srgrimes}
